The Site Coordinator will be responsible for day-to-day site
operations. This person will coordinate and monitor all site
operations, including site communications, vendor management, space
/ utilization management and ensuring site is clean organized and
follows safety regulations provided by EH&S. This role will
interact daily with vendors and employees to maintain and help
provide a professional workplace. The facilities coordinator
reports to the Facilities Site Manager. What you can do:
- Responsible for assisting with & coordinating maintenance and
general repairs of the facility such as cleaning services and
specialized work orders by conducting daily comprehensive tours of
floor space, identifying defects, and taking corrective actions as
required.
- Track maintenance work orders and inventory of various facility
supplies
- Create, inspect and maintain logs for light equipment such as
fork trucks/lifts, compressors and generators
- Analyze and identify faults or problems in equipment and
machinery and keep them in working order
- Perform minor maintenance of vehicles and equipment including
filling up with gasoline, oils, and fluids
- Schedule the work of vendors (such as HVAC, repairs,
carpenters, electricians, plumbers, painters) and oversee
contractor and vendor work and conduct inspection once complete to
ensure that quality of work meets company standards
- Respond to all service requests in a prompt manner and escalate
problems as necessary
- Assist in ensuring the safety of occupants which includes the
provisioning of emergency equipment & supplies, works with building
management, and participates in building safety/emergency
programs
- Work with sub-contractors on repairs, installations, small
construction and/or remodeling, enhancement/improvement projects
and maintenance projects
- Assist with after-hours and weekend emergency calls involving
facility needs
- Maintain office related inventory & supplies
- Provide system administration and operational responsibility
for security system which includes setting up ID badges and guest
passes, regular audits of system, providing quarterly reports and
making changes in response to reviews
- Complete office moves under direct supervision
- Perform and assist with other tasks and special projects as
required or as assigned by supervisor
- Respond to and close in a timely manner Facility tickets/email
requests
- Maintain and update Facilities system, user, and operational
documents; creates new documents as required; reviews and updates
documentation on a regular schedule
- Other duties as assigned What you can contribute:
